PRODUCT Properties
| Melting point: | 233-234° |
| Flash point: | 9°C |
| storage temp. | 2-8°C |
| solubility | Soluble in DMSO (40 mg/ml) |
| pka | 7.9(at 25℃) |
| form | solid |
| color | white |
| Water Solubility | Soluble in water (>25 mg/ml), ethanol 193mg/ml, 0.1 N HCl 333 mg/ml |
| Merck | 14,1499 |
| Stability: | Stable for 2 years from date of purchase as supplied. Solutions in DMSO may be stored at -20°C for up to 3 months. |
| LogP | 3.468 (est) |
Description and Uses
Bupropion HCl (31677-94-7) is a clinically useful antidepressant that inhibits monoamine transporters DAT, NET, and SERT (Kis for dopamine uptake = 2.8, 1.4, 45 μM).1 Also acts as a noncompetitive antagonist at nicotinic acetylcholine receptors (AChRs).2 At higher concentrations (50 μM), stimulates pro-inflammatory cytokines and TLR2/TLR4 and JAK2/STAT3 in human peripheral blood mononuclear cells (PBMCs).3
Antidepressant.
